Do your thing – the Hobo’s right there with you. It’s tough and easy to pack. With wide tyres, so you can experience more. A gravel bike for everyday use – anything but ordinary.

Change gears easily. Brake safely.

As robust and straightforward as your Hobo: The Shimano Cues gives you a full 10 gears – from fast to relaxed, with plenty in reserve for steep sections. You can change gears with just one hand, and even under load, it’s almost effortless. Hydraulic brakes with large discs bring you to a safe stop in all weathers.

Space for the things you love

The Hobo comes with a built-in rack and two elastic Hobo straps. Take everything with you and keep an eye on it – from your backpack to your rain jacket. The removable front luggage rack is securely attached to the frame of the Hobo. This means that nothing wobbles when you're steering, and everything stays balanced.

Gravel vibes & flat bar feel

Whether you’re commuting fast in the city or cruising leisurely through the countryside, the straight flat bar lets you sit in a more upright position whilst giving you a better view of the road. With its ergonomic angle and reduced width, it combines confident control off-road with agile handling in the hustle and bustle of everyday life.

Classification

Classification

Category 2

This category applies to bicycles and e-bikes* that meet the conditions of category 1 and are ridden on normal roads as well as in category 2 on unpaved roads and gravel paths with moderate inclines and descents. The tyres are in constant contact with the ground at average speed and they are only occasionally ridden over steps and drops of less than 15 cm. These conditions can lead to contact with uneven terrain and the tyre repeatedly losing contact with the ground. The intended use is, for example, recreational riding. You don’t require any special riding skills.

Average speed 15 to 25 km/h

Height of steps and drops: < 15 cm
